India, April 2 -- Passenger vehicle sales in FY22 grew 13% from the previous year despite supply chain bottlenecks, company figures released on Friday showed, as demand for personal mobility rose. Car market leader Maruti Suzuki sold 170,395 units in March, marginally above the 167,014 units in March 2021. In FY22, its sales grew 13.4% at 1,652,653 units. Indian automakers count despatches to wholesalers as sales.
